Приходите к нам работать. Нам нужны:

1. Специалист технической поддержки

Требуемый опыт работы: 1–3 года.

Полная занятость, полный день.

Задачи:

— Работа в качестве специалиста ServiceDesk. Поддержка пользователей в главном офисе и удаленная поддержка регионов-штабов. — Помощь техническому специалисту в решении проблем (ASAP) в части поддержки сетевой инфраструктуры, телефонии (подключение телефонов в офисе), офисной оргтехники (не бояться выходящих из строя принтеров). — Настройка и установка ПО и оборудования рабочих станций сотрудников. Выявление и устранение ошибок. — Обеспечение проведения видеоконференций и презентаций. — Замена расходных материалов в оргтехнике (в том числе их учет). — Участие в подборе аудио-, видео-, сетевого, компьютерного оборудования. — Написание технической документации (руководства пользователя, ТО). — Работа в крутой команде техников на больших мероприятиях.

Требования:

— Техническое образование. — Знание основ языков программирования. — Знание linux (основ командной строки), macOS, windows и прочих ОС на уровне продвинутого пользователя. — Умение подобрать нужный дистрибутив, установить/переустановить/зашифровать систему и подготовить рабочую машину для сотрудников. — Понимание основных правил и принципов информационной безопасности. — Общие или начальные представления о функционировании сетей, модели ISO/OSI, DHCP, DNS, систем VPN. — Знакомство с линейкой сетевого оборудования Tplink, Mikrotik, Ubiquity, arm микрокомпьютеров (опыт работы хотя бы с одним из них). — Опыт работы с аудио- и видеооборудованием. — Желание использовать свой технический бэкграунд для борьбы с жуликами и ворами, стремление развиваться. — Большим плюсом будет опыт работы с Zabbix/Grafana, GitHub/Bitbucket.

Условия:

— Работа в офисе в Москве. — 5/2 или по согласованию. — Зарплата по результатам собеседования. — Офис в пределах ТТК (3 минуты от метро, 10 минут от МЦК).

Вакансия в первую очередь подойдет начинающим специалистам, желающим развиваться. Для тех, кто не боится задач разной направленности и любит находить нестандартные технические решения в условиях сжатых сроков и ограниченных ресурсов.

В сопроводительном письме кратко опишите один или несколько успешно выполненных проектов, личных или командных, над которыми вам приходилось работать. Это может быть все что угодно — то, чем вы могли бы гордиться в плане своего профессионального роста. Какие технологии вы использовали, чему научились, что было для вас самым сложным?

Ждем ваше резюме на почту dev@navalny.com с пометкой «Специалист техподдержки».

2. Техлид

Требуемый опыт работы: 1–3 года.

Загруженность — фултайм, но график может быть гибким. Возможна удаленная работа.

Зарплата по результатам собеседования.

Мы ищем специалиста с большим опытом веб-разработки на позицию техлида. От кандидата мы ждем высокого уровня технической экспертизы, особенно в области отказоустойчивости.

Несмотря на небольшое количество разработчиков, IT-отдел ФБК работает над несколькими крупными проектами одновременно, и десятки проектов находятся в поддержке.

Нам нужен человек, который будет контролировать техническую сторону разработки, отвечать за успешный запуск и дальнейшую жизнь проекта, несмотря на все неожиданные препятствия, блокировки и атаки.

Вы будете работать вместе с небольшой командой фронтенд- и бэкенд-разработчиков, а также DevOps-инженеров.

Основные задачи:

— участие в установочных встречах по проектам; — оценка и декомпозиция высокоуровневых задач; — проектирование архитектуры сервисов; — оптимизация существующих сервисов; — code-review; — участие в подготовке проектов к запуску; — поддержание проектов в хорошей форме, борьба с атаками и блокировками.

Требования к кандидату:

— серьезный опыт backend-разработки; — знание Python на хорошем уровне; — понимание особенностей работы с высоконагруженными проектами; — понимание характера нагрузки и основных направлений атак на веб-приложения; — способность видеть общую картину проекта; — способность переключаться между разными задачами.

Наш основной стек технологий:

— Python (Django и немного aiohttp) — PostgreSQL и SQLite — Docker, Docker Compose, Kubernetes — GitLab, Youtrack

Знание Go будет большим дополнительным плюсом.

Мы готовы менять стек, учитывая реалии современной разработки, прислушиваться к вашему опыту и использовать другие технологии, но кандидат должен понимать, что большинство наших проектов невозможно будет переписать одномоментно и их необходимо будет поддерживать.

Мы ждем от кандидата отклик вместе с выполненным техническим заданием. Придумайте архитектуру приложения ФБК, которое будет включать новостную ленту, блок с видеорасследованиями, регистрацию пользователя и подписку на новости, соцопросы, пуши. Успешно выполненным заданием будет считаться небольшой технический документ, описывающий компоненты системы, их интерфейсы, админку, деплоймент и защиту от блокировок.

Ждем ваше резюме на почту dev@navalny.com с пометкой «Техлид».

3. Бэкенд-разработчик

Мы ищем бэкендера для работы над существующими и новыми проектами.

Требуемый опыт работы: 1–3 года.

Загруженность — фултайм, но график может быть гибким. Возможна удаленная работа.

Зарплата по результатам собеседования.

Требования к кандидату:

— серьезный опыт backend-разработки; — знание Python на хорошем уровне, хорошее знание Django и представление о других серверных фреймворках; — понимание особенностей работы с высоконагруженными проектами; — понимание работы реляционных баз на хорошем уровне; — понимание характера нагрузки и основных направлений атак на веб-приложения; — способность видеть общую картину проекта; — способность переключаться между разными задачами.

Наш основной стек технологий:

— Python (Django и немного aiohttp) — PostgreSQL и SQLite — Docker, Docker Compose, Kubernetes — GitLab, Youtrack, Slack

Мы готовы менять стек, учитывая реалии современной разработки, прислушиваться к вашему опыту и использовать другие технологии, но кандидат должен понимать, что большинство наших проектов невозможно будет переписать одномоментно и их необходимо будет поддерживать.

Знание Go будет большим дополнительным плюсом.

Мы ждем от кандидата отклик вместе с выполненным техническим заданием. Предложите свой вариант, как реализовать автокомплит ввода адреса в блок регистрации, на примере сайта «Умного голосования»: https://votesmart.appspot.com/#register.

Необходимо, чтобы ввод адреса был неупорядоченным, умел распознавать корпуса и строения в разных видах написания, понимать пробелы, римские цифры (и прочее, что, на ваш взгляд, необходимо), создавать минимальное количество запросов и справляться с нагрузкой.

Ждем ваше резюме с выполненным техническим заданием на почту dev@navalny.com с пометкой «Бэкенд-разработчик».

4. DevOps-инженер

Требуемый опыт работы: 1–3 года.

Загруженность — фултайм, но график может быть гибким. Возможна удаленная работа.

Зарплата по результатам собеседования.

Профессиональные требования:

— знание Docker и K8s; — знание nginx, плюсом будет опыт кэширования; — опыт работы с облаками (GCE, AWS и так далее); — знание bash, Python (опыт работы с Django будет плюсом); — опыт работы с PostgreSQL; — опыт работы с Jenkins, понимание Jenkins Pipelines (плюсом будет знание shared libraries); — знание Git; — понимание процессов CI/CD и умение их использовать на практике; — опыт работы с Prometheus.

Плюсом будет:

— опыт поддержки RESTful приложений; — опыт поддержки sphinx; — опыт работы с Podman, Rancher и так далее; — опыт работы с ELK, EFK или прочими агрегаторами логов.

Если вас заинтересовала эта вакансия, выполните тестовое задание:

1. Напишите на Python скрипт, который будет из POST запроса писать значение в базу данных (использовать Postgres). 2. Скрипт и БД должны быть упакованы в Docker. 3. Настройте nginx, который будет запрещать GET-запросы к скрипту. 4. Все должно запускаться из docker-compose.yml. 5. Все сервисы должны общаться между собой через внутреннюю сеть Docker. Nginx должен быть доступен на порту 8080. 6. Код, Dockerfile и docker-compose.yml выложите в публичный доступ на GitHub.

Ждем ваше резюме с выполненным техническим заданием на почту dev@navalny.com с пометкой «DevOps».

5. Команда Навального ищет SMM-редактора в Москве

Чем придётся заниматься?

SMM-редактор — это наставник наших коллег в регионах. Вы будете помогать им вести сообщества в социальных сетях, давать советы в соответствии с нашим SMM-гидом, рекомендовать эффективные приёмы для роста активности и напрямую редактировать тексты при необходимости. Иногда вы будете писать в соцсети и самостоятельно: например, вести прямые трансляции в текстовом или видеоформате.

Что мы ждём от кандидата?

— Интерес к политике — Знание специфики работы различных соцсетей (FB, ВК, OK, Youtube, Telegram, Instagram, TikTok) — Владение программным обеспечением для работы с соцсетями — Владение программным обеспечением для работы с аудио, видео и фото — Знание механизмов продвижения в соцсетях и SMM-инструментов — Опыт написания текстов, отличное знание русского языка — Успешный опыт по выстраиванию отношений с аудиторией — Нацеленность на результат, ответственность

Резюме присылайте на почту: smm@navalny-team.org

6. Юрист

Нам нужен юрист широкого профиля.

Задачи:

— Регулярно судиться с органами исполнительной власти (обжалование бездействия прежде всего), разбираться в сложных случаях, вникать в особенности кипрского и бермудского права. — Жалобы/суды/выборы/расследования/«административка в поле».

Требования:

— Идейность. Желание бороться с коррупционерами. — Инициативность и креативность. — Ответственность и исполнительность в процедурной части. Сроки, номера, входящие/исходящие. — Знание административного и гражданского процесса, кодекса административного судопроизводства, знание гражданского права. — Приветствуется опыт работы на избирательных кампаниях. — Способность писать и формулировать не только юридическим, но и человеческим языком. — Веселый и добрый нрав, способность работать в команде. — Общая юридическая смелость.

Условия:

— Судебный опыт обязателен. — Зарплата по результатам собеседования.

Присылайте свои резюме на почту gimadi@fbk.info с пометкой «Отклик на вакансию».

Оригинал